Visiting Kailua Kona, it’s never hard to know if a cruise ship is in. They invariably are the largest thing in view, dwarfing any and all of the downtown buildings. On a recent visit, I got this photo from the Walmart parking lot (a solid contender for the Walmart with the best view in the world!).
It used to be that Wednesday was cruise ship day, but currently there are three or four ships a week stopping by. This one is the Europa 2, which is operated by Hapag-Lloyd Cruises. It carries up to 516 passengers, which means it is less crowded than most cruise ships.
